Euclid and Archimedes are just two of the ancient Greek mathematicians to have studied conic sections —the shapes created by slicing through a double cone with a flat plane. If the plane is perpendicular to the axis of the double cone, the intersection is a circle, and if the plane is angled parallel to the side ...
